**Segments**
- On the basis of type, the bispecific antibody market can be segmented into IgG-like Molecules, Non-IgG-like Molecules.
- Based on the application, the market can be divided into Oncology, Autoimmune Diseases, Infectious Diseases, Neurodegenerative Diseases, Others.
- By end-users, the market is categorized into Hospitals, Specialty Clinics, Research & Academic Institutes, Others.
- Geographically,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, South America, Middle East, and Africa.
Bispecific antibodies have gained significant attention in recent years due to their enhanced therapeutic potential compared to traditional monoclonal antibodies. The market segment based on type is crucial as IgG-like molecules are predominantly used in the development of bispecific antibodies due to their structural similarity to natural antibodies, while non-IgG-like molecules offer unique mechanisms of action that can target specific diseases more effectively. In terms of applications, oncology holds a dominant position in the market as bispecific antibodies have shown promising results in targeting cancer cells with increased specificity and reduced side effects. Other applications such as autoimmune diseases and infectious diseases are also driving market growth. With end-users, hospitals and specialty clinics are major contributors to the market revenue due to the increasing adoption of bispecific antibodies in clinical settings.

One of the emerging trends in the market is the development of novel bispecific antibody platforms that offer enhanced efficacy and safety profiles compared to traditional monoclonal antibodies. Companies are focusing on novel engineering techniques to design bispecific antibodies that can simultaneously target multiple disease pathways, leading to improved treatment outcomes for patients.
Moreover, the growing prevalence of chronic diseases such as cancer, autoimmune disorders, and infectious diseases is fueling the demand for bispecific antibodies as they offer a more precise and potent mechanism of action compared to conventional therapies. In addition, the expanding research activities in the field of immunotherapy and immuno-oncology are driving the adoption of bispecific antibodies as promising treatment options for patients with difficult-to-treat conditions.
Another key factor shaping the bispecific antibody market is the increasing investment in biopharmaceutical research and development by both established companies and emerging players. Companies are investing in advanced technologies and manufacturing processes to enhance the production and scalability of bispecific antibodies, ensuring efficient and cost-effective commercialization of these innovative therapies. Strategic collaborations, licensing agreements, and mergers and acquisitions are also playing a crucial role in expanding the market presence of key players and accelerating the development of novel bispecific antibody candidates.
Furthermore, the geographic segmentation of the bispecific antibody market highlights regional trends and opportunities for market expansion. North America continues to dominate the market due to the presence of a well-established healthcare infrastructure, increasing R&D investments, and a high prevalence of target diseases such as cancer and autoimmune disorders. Europe is also a significant market for bispecific antibodies, driven by the rising adoption of advanced therapeutics and a growing emphasis on personalized medicine.
